I recently started raising the babies from my Wyoming White (female) & Darwin (male) clownfish. The baby in the pictures is about 6 weeks old. It looks like a Wyoming White but has a single black stripe near its tail. It is also starting to show some blue coloration.

I have lots of questions. I haven’t seen another clownfish like this. Is mine even sellable? Is there a name for it? Should I keep it to try and bring out more blue in future generations? If so, any ideas on how this can be done?

Blue hue is not anything new among designer clowns...snow onyx and snowflake clowns in particular. It is not considered a deformity thus making it sellable provided your clown looks good otherwise.

Totally normal for certain designer clownfish. Every snowflake clownfish I’ve ever owned (I think 6 of them now), have had a little blue hue right where the black meets the white coloration on them! ;)
